Concrete services encompass a range of solutions aimed at installing, repairing, and maintaining concrete surfaces. These services typically involve tasks such as pouring new concrete for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and foundations, as well as repairing cracks, holes, or uneven areas in existing concrete structures. Contractors may also offer finishing techniques to enhance the durability and appearance of concrete surfaces, including stamping, staining, or sealing. The goal is to create a solid, functional surface that can withstand regular use and environmental factors.
These services help address common problems like cracking, spalling, and uneven settling that can compromise the safety and appearance of concrete surfaces. Over time, exposure to weather, ground movement, and heavy use can lead to deterioration, making repairs necessary to prevent further damage. Proper installation and timely maintenance can extend the lifespan of concrete surfaces, reducing the need for complete replacements and ensuring that properties remain safe and visually appealing.

Concrete Installation Costs - The cost for installing new concrete typ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, with an average around $6. For example, a 10x10 driveway might cost between $300 and $1,000 depending on complexity and materials.
Concrete Repair Expenses - Repair services generally fall between $300 and $1,200, depending on the extent of damage. Small cracks might cost around $150, while larger sections needing replacement could reach $1,000 or more.
Concrete Finishing Prices - Finishing work, such as smoothing or stamping, can add $2 to $8 per square foot to the project. A 200-square-foot area might therefore cost between $400 and $1,600 for finishing services.
Cost Factors to Consider - Overall costs vary based on project size, design complexity, and local labor rates. For example, decorative finishes or reinforced concrete may increase expenses beyond basic installation or repair est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
